Join SCONUL Access

Step One: Join Sconul Access

To join the scheme, please register online at the Sconul Access website

Click on the 'Sconul Access' tab or on the 'Get Access' link and complete the form online including selecting the institution you wish to visit and click 'submit'.  You will receive an email receipt showing your application as 'pending'.

Applications are approved subject to you not having any overdue books or any other issues with your library account. Once your application is approved, you will receive an email confirmation containing your registration details and your membership expiry date. 

Step Two: Register at a participating library

You  can see an A to Z of participating libraries that support your user category.by completing the first part of the Sconul Access application form.   

You will need your Sconul Access confirmation email and University of Greenwich student ID card to register at each library.

Please check the Sconul Access webpage of your chosen library for procedures as these can vary from one institution to another.For example, some libraries may require a passport photograph, some are only able to register new users during office hours, and some restrict access to their own students during the busy exam periods.

Access to Wi-Fi is available via the eduroam network at participating institutions. 

Please note: Your library account will be blocked if any items on your account go overdue. We automatically renew all items whenever possible. However if one of the items on your account is reserved, you will need to bring it back, we will email you when this is the case.
